Undergraduate Tuition & Fees

The following table compares 2023-2024 undergraduate tuition & fees between selected colleges. The average undergraduate tuition & fees is $27,875 for all students. The 2023-2024 undergraduate tuition & fees of selected colleges are increased by 3.15% compared to the previous year.
Among the selected colleges, Adrian College requires the most expensive tuition & fees of $40,556 and Grace Christian University has the lowest tuition & fees of $14,992 for undergraduate programs.

Graduate Tuition & Fees

The following table compares 2023-2024 graduate tuition & fees between selected colleges. The average graduate tuition & fees is $16,328 for all students. The 2023-2024 graduate tuition & fees of selected colleges are increased by 9.07% compared to the previous year.
Among the selected colleges, Adrian College requires the most expensive graduate tuition & fees of $20,150 and Grace Christian University has the lowest graduate tuition & fees of $11,520.
